Pain at the front of the knee is very common, and its proper name is ‘anterior knee pain’. Usually, it’s caused by tightness in the quads or the fibrous tissue that runs alongside the outer leg – the Iliotibial band – pulling on the patella (knee cap). This can be down to bike fit, or tightness as a result of a lack of … See more It's important to remember that the knee is effectively a hinge between the hip and the ankle. It's very rare that the problem is actually with the knee itself. Monger-Godfrey explains: … See more So what can we do about pain at the front of the knee? First – it’s a good idea to check your bike fit.Monger-Godfrey says: “[Pain at the front of the knee] often arises from the saddle being too low and too far forward. WebJul 14, 2024 · Cycling can be incredibly gentle on the knees if done correctly, as it is considered low impact. In fact, research shows that stationary cycling exercise relieves pain and improves sports function in individuals with knee osteoarthritis. However, common riding mistakes are why people experience knee pain, not the bikes themselves. WebFeb 20, 2024 · Knee pain is primarily caused by seat distance and seat height. A too-low bike causes your quadriceps and hip flexors to overwork and put extra strain on your knees due to poor extension. Otherwise, a tall person’s knee can hyperextend at the pedal stroke’s bottom. Overuse of your quadriceps and hip flexors contributes to this discomfort.
